Conor McGregors Appeal Dismissed in Civil Sexual Assault Case

Former MMA champion Conor McGregor has lost his appeal against a civil jury's finding of sexual assault. This article details the Dublin Court of Appeal's decision, the grounds for the appeal, and the reaffirmation of the original damages awarded to the complainant.


A Legal Setback: McGregor's Appeal Against Civil Finding DismissedIn a significant legal development for the former two-division UFC champion, Conor McGregor's appeal against a civil jury's finding that he sexually assaulted a woman has been dismissed. The Court of Appeal in Dublin today, July 31, 2025, rejected all five grounds of McGregor's legal challenge, upholding the original verdict in favour of the complainant, Nikita Hand.

The ruling means that the High Court's November 2023 decision, which found McGregor liable for assaulting Ms. Hand in a Dublin hotel in 2018 and ordered him to pay substantial damages and legal costs, stands firm. This outcome marks a notable legal setback for the prominent mixed martial artist, whose legal battles continue to draw considerable public attention.

The Original Case and the Grounds for AppealThe civil case stemmed from allegations made by Nikita Hand, who accused McGregor of "brutally raping and battering" her in a penthouse suite at the Beacon Hotel. During the three-week civil trial in November 2023, McGregor vehemently denied the allegations, maintaining that the encounter was consensual. The jury, however, found him civilly liable for assault, leading to an order to pay Ms. Hand approximately £206,000 in damages, in addition to significant legal costs.

McGregor's legal team launched an appeal based on several key grounds, seeking to overturn the jury's decision. Among the primary arguments were:

Wording on the "Issue Paper": A central point of contention was the wording on the "issue paper" presented to the jurors, which asked whether "Conor McGregor assaulted Nikita Hand." McGregor's barrister argued that it should have specifically stated "sexual assault," contending that the broader term "assault" could have misled the jury. However, Ms. Hand's legal counsel countered that "assault" encompasses a range of acts, and the context of the trial clearly indicated they were dealing with "assault by rape." The Court of Appeal ultimately agreed that the jury would not have been confused.

"No Comment" Responses in Police Interviews: Another significant ground of appeal involved the inclusion of McGregor's "no comment" responses during police interviews. His legal team argued that allowing these responses into evidence could have unfairly prejudiced the jury, potentially violating his right to silence by suggesting guilt. Ms. Hand's team, however, pointed out that no motion was made during the original trial to dismiss the jury based on this issue, undermining the severity of the complaint. The Court of Appeal found that the trial judge had adequately warned the jury about not drawing adverse inferences from these responses.

Withdrawal of New Evidence: Earlier in July, McGregor's legal team had unexpectedly withdrawn a bid to introduce new evidence as part of the appeal. This proposed evidence, from former neighbours of Ms. Hand, was initially intended to suggest an alternative explanation for bruising on Ms. Hand's body. The dramatic withdrawal of this crucial element further highlighted the challenges faced by McGregor's appeal.

The Court of Appeal's DecisionReading out the ruling on behalf of the three-judge panel, Mr. Justice Brian O'Moore stated, "I find there is nothing in them [the grounds for appeal] to justify setting aside the finding of the jury. I therefore dismiss the appeal in its entirety."

Ms. Hand was present in court for the verdict, embraced by her supporters. Conor McGregor himself was not in attendance. The dismissal of the appeal on all grounds signifies a complete rejection of his arguments and firmly upholds the original civil court judgment.

With the appeal now fully rejected, the original civil court ruling and the substantial damages award against Conor McGregor remain in place. This outcome represents a clear legal defeat for the athlete.

While criminal charges in this particular case were not pursued by prosecutors due to insufficient evidence, the civil standard of proof is lower. The civil finding of liability means that the court has determined, on the balance of probabilities, that the assault occurred as alleged.

This decision adds to McGregor's ongoing legal challenges, both in Ireland and internationally. For Ms. Hand, the ruling provides a reaffirmation of the initial jury's findings and the established compensation. It underscores the distinct nature of civil proceedings in seeking justice for alleged harms.
